"Ancient Martial Arts in Traditional Hanfu Fashion: Exploring the Essence of Chinese Martial Arts Culture in Classic Attire" In the realm of Chinese culture, there exists a unique and enchanting blend of art and history, which manifests itself in the form of Hanfu. Hanfu, also known as Han clothing, is a traditional style of clothing that dates back over thousands of years in China’s historical context. It embodies the essence of Chinese aesthetics and culture, often seen as a symbol of unity and continuity. When Hanfu is combined with the allure of martial arts, it creates a captivating display of ancient artistry and prowess that transcends time. The martial arts in Hanfu fashion have always been an integral part of Chinese culture. These arts are not just about physical combat or self-defense; they are also a form of expression, a way to cultivate inner peace and harmony. The graceful movements and intricate forms of martial arts movements are often seen in the intricate patterns and designs of Hanfu clothing. The two elements complement each other, with the clothing showcasing the grace and power of the martial artist. The intricate designs and vibrant colors of Hanfu are often influenced by the themes and elements of martial arts culture. The use of symbols like dragons and phoenixes, which are often associated with power and courage, are often seen in both martial arts and Hanfu designs. These symbols not only add to the aesthetic value of the clothing but also serve as a reminder of the deep-rooted cultural values that Hanfu represents.
